Simmental is an influential breed of cattle whose history dates back to the Middle Ages. Early records indicate that Simmental cattle were the result of a cross between large German cattle and a smaller breed indigenous to Switzerland. The name Simmental is derived from the name of the area where the cattle were first bred-the Simme Valley.

DEF

The distribution of flesh on animals.

CONT

Animals with the frame size and degree of fleshing of Simmental will require more total ration than their smaller framed counterpart but they have a higher rate of feed efficiency.(Document on the Simmental breed).

OBS

In Canada, the term "fleshing" is sometimes incorrectly used to mean the finish of the carcass ["état d’engraissement", in French].
